Info record mandatory for shopping cart creation in SRM classic scneario

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i Gurus,

We are creating shopping cart in our SRM 7.01 system in classic mode. We have not created any info record for the product category and vendor in the backend ECC system.

Do we need create an info record for the particular combination of material group/material and supplier in the ECC backend system so that the shopping cart in SRM classic scenario creates a PO directly in the system?

All you need is the source of supply, a direct vendor or a contract will do to create you PO as classic.

You are correct but you need to make sure the entered vendor or contracts exists in your ERP system.

To test this you can try creating a PO directly in the ERP system with the vendor and material you need with no info record and it will work.

You must have an info record or a contract in the backend in case you are ordering free text items. (This is because price is picked from these 2 sources)

However if you are shopping via a catalog, then PIR is not needed.
